Carlos Tejada is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and Astronomy and Astrophysics. According to data from OpenAlex, Carlos Tejada has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 260 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 9 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and 9 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ics. Recurrent topics in Carlos Tejada’s work include Adaptive optics and wavefront sensing (9 papers), Stellar, planetary, and galactic studies (6 papers) and Astronomy and Astrophysical Research (5 papers). Carlos Tejada is often cited by papers focused on Adaptive optics and wavefront sensing (9 papers), Stellar, planetary, and galactic studies (6 papers) and Astronomy and Astrophysical Research (5 papers). Carlos Tejada collaborates with scholars based in Mexico, Spain and Cuba. Carlos Tejada's co-authors include Gary J. Hill, Phillip J. MacQueen, Wolfgang Mitsch, H. Nicklas, J. Cepa, J. González‐Hernández, E. Joven, Joss Bland‐Hawthorn, Carmelo Militello and J. I. González‐Serrano and has published in prestigious journals such as Energies, IEEE Latin America Transactions and Proceedings of SPIE, the International Society for Optical Engineering/Proceedings of SPIE.
